This is a second chance love story so to say, as two best friends make a bet as teens at hockey camp the summer before heading to college. Their friendship lasts the test of time and their budding relationship is so sweet, perfect and sexy. It comes to a satisfying ending if you choose to stop here but I am going right on to the next book, Us!

Jamie figures out he's bi, not just gay for Ryan, which I appreciated (I'm not a fan of GFY, as it mostly strikes me as false). The goofy friendship between these two just felt so organic, and seeing them eventually turn into something more was absolutely lovely. My only complaint is that the book is a bit wattpady and the book is veryyyy spicy but other than that I loved it.
